Device comparison
Saga device comparison (PDF)
Model type | Saga Standard | Saga Arctic | Saga-P Dry Ice | Saga-P Cryogenic |
|---|---|---|---|---|
Device | Saga | Saga | Saga-P | Saga-P |
Use case | Cold and ambient | Deep freeze (-30°C) | Dry ice (-95°C) | Liquid nitrogen (-200°C) |
Probe | N/A | N/A | PR-T80 | PR-T80 |
Standard operating temperature range | +50°C -20°C | +30°C -30°C | +50°C -95°C | +50°C -200°C |
Standard temperature calibration points (calibrated to NIST traceable standard) | Device: +50°C +15°C -20°C | Device: +30°C +15°C -30°C | Probe: 0°C -40°C -80°C | Probe: 0°C -40°C -80°C -196°C |
Temperature accuracy | ±0.5°C at -10°C to +45°C ±1°C at +45°C to +50°C | -20°C to -10°C | ±0.5°C at -10°C to +10°C ±1°C at +10°C to +30°C | -30°C to -10°C | ±1.0°C | ±1.4°C at -200°C to -90°C ±1°C at -90°C to 0°C |
Resolution | 0.1°C | |||
Long-term drift | <0.1°C per year | |||
Temperature data recording interval | 10 minutes, fixed | |||
Upload interval - battery life (Hours between upload - expected battery life) | 1h – 20 days 2h – 35 days 3h – 45 days 6h – 75 days 12h – 110 days 24h – >110 days | 1h – 10 days 2h – 17 days 3h – 22 days 6h – 37 days 12h – 55 days 24h – >55 days | 1h – 20 days 2h – 35 days 3h – 45 days 6h – 75 days 12h – 110 days 24h – >110 days | 1h – 20 days 2h – 35 days 3h – 45 days 6h – 75 days 12h – 110 days 24h – >110 days |
Battery capacity | 2500mAh | 1200mAh | 2500mAh | 2500mAh |
All devices
Battery type - Rechargeable NiMH, battery life of at least 70 charge cycles, not considered dangerous goods
Data storage on device - >150 days of temperature measurements, or 21,600 data points at 10 minute intervals
Recharging/ backup data retrieval - Via attached USB-A cable
Programmable alarms - Configurable alert notifications for temperature excursions
Light sensor - Significant changes in light intensity trigger alert notifications
Real-time monitoring - In case of excursion, device will attempt to connect unless in flight mode
Display - E Ink display showing alarm status, current temperature and min + max temperature during shipment
Multi use - Devices are constructed from responsibly sourced materials and designed for extended durability
Certified for flights - Automatic flight mode - approved by over 200 airlines
Location tracking - Location tracked for each data upload using cellular triangulation. WiFi detection via 2.4Ghz WPS (receive only)
Geofencing - Radius configurable from 250m to 15km
Network capability - Global - 4G (LTE), 3G, or 2G
